WebMar 31, 2024 · Finally, we simply use the corresponding hexadecimal digits to write out the base-16 number, 5D 16. We can also go in the other direction, by converting each hexadecimal digit into four binary digits. Try converting B7 16 to binary. You should get 10110111 2. This trick works because 16 is a power of 2. WebThe Cisco UCS VIC 1227 is designed for use only on Cisco UCS C-Series Rack Servers.
